Jordan Reyes | Prep Redzone Scout
One of the best available quarterbacks in the 2026 class, he holds an offer from Cornell and is ranked as the No. 6 QB and No. 60 overall prospect in the PRZ state rankings. He operates with smooth, efficient movement in the pocket, staying balanced while feeling and avoiding pressure with natural poise. His arm talent stands out he can push the ball vertically with ease or drive throws with velocity to the short and intermediate areas. A plus athlete, he’s able to extend plays outside the pocket and threaten defenses as a runner when he tucks the ball. With his blend of athletic ability, pocket control, and arm strength, he brings one of the most complete quarterback skill sets still on the board.

Read EvaluationHunter Tierney | Prep Redzone Scout
Gunner’s game against Brophy is the kind you circle when you talk about having command when the lights get brightest. This season has been less about piling up totals and more about how and when he delivers. You can see the senior experience shine through every week. He played clean and poised through three quarters of that Brophy game, then tightened the screws in the fourth and overtime — working quick-game on time, trusting his eyes on out routes, using his legs to buy time when he needed to, and ripping a few money throws over the middle when the pocket squeezed and he couldn’t escape. The ball comes out with some serious power behind it. He’s got that natural strength that allows him to throw it to any part of the field. Add in the situational mastery — like his ability to find the mismatch the second a defense blinks — and you get a clutch closer who just delivered a comeback over a really good defense. The stat line pops because of the moment, but the tape says the same thing every week: calm feet, quick processing, and the confidence to make the right throw even when it’s not the flashy one.

Read EvaluationHunter Tierney | Prep Redzone Scout
Gunner Fagrell Gunner Fagrell 6'1" | 190 lbs | QB Higley | 2026 State AZ ‘s season at Higley was nothing short of spectacular, blending undeniable, raw talent with an astute understanding of the game. Leading Higley on a 5A championship run, Fagrell looked calm and poised in each and every game. A quarterback who excels with deceptive speed and an uncanny ability to dissect defenses. He has a great balance between taking risks when the opportunity presents itself, while also being open to taking whatever the defense gives him. This all leads to his game looking much more mature and refined than you’d expect from a sophomore. His journey this season – highlighted by leadership in crucial moments and an unwavering poise under pressure – will prove to be extremely valuable experience for him moving forward. Fagrell’s arm strength, coupled with exceptional footwork and impressive accuracy, combine to torment opposing secondaries. Finishing his sophomore campaign leading all of 5A in total yards (3,593) with a 65.3% completion rate, he put the state on notice. If he’s able to add some weight onto his tall frame and work on his burst, he could add another dynamic element to his game and make himself nearly impossible to defend. As he continues to grow, Fagrell embodies the complete package. His ascent to the third-ranked QB (with a case to be higher) in his class is a testament to his hard work and potential, making his progress in the off-season something to watch.
